Definitions:

B2C

Refers to Business to Consumer, a business model in which businesses sell products or services directly to consumers.

B2B

Business-to-business, a commercial transaction between businesses, such as between a manufacturer and a wholesaler, or between a wholesaler and a retailer.

C2B

Consumer-to-Business, a business model where consumers create value and businesses consume that value; for example, customer reviews or selling products online to companies.

Internet

A global network connecting millions of computers to facilitate data exchange.
